2008 BMW 525 vs. 2008 Citroen Picasso

To start off, both 2008 BMW 525 and 2008 Citroen Picasso were released in the same year (2008).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 2,495 cc (6 cylinders), 2008 BMW 525 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 BMW 525 (175 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 67 more horse power than 2008 Citroen Picasso. (108 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 BMW 525 should accelerate faster than 2008 Citroen Picasso.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 BMW 525 weights approximately 420 kg more than 2008 Citroen Picasso.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2008 BMW 525 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2008 BMW 525.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Citroen Picasso,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 BMW 525 (400 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 159 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Citroen Picasso. (241 Nm @ 1750 RPM). This means 2008 BMW 525 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Citroen Picasso.
